A friendly waiter in a small & cosy restaurant. For Starters we ordered 'Queso Ferret' which is melted cheese + compote (jam) served with small tostas. This was 'different & nice'. Mains were black pig cheeks served with fried sliced potatoes & apple sauce. The...cheeks were tender & tasted lovely. Personally I would have preferred oven/baked potatoes & not fried ones (not a great fan of chips). The apple sauce was nice but would have preferred it warm - overall a very nice dish. The best was saved for last! The dessert 'bola maca'. Eventhough the waiter described it as apple pie it was more of an apple & walnut cake with some icecream. It was HEAVEN IN A CAKE. Moist apple flavour with chunks of walnuts-10/10. I asked for recipe but was told it's restaurant secret 😉🍰 Total bill 47€ - Overall a very satisfying lunch.More
